What is the difference between Remote Rota vs Remote Nurse?
Career: Remote Rota
| Aspect | Remote Rota | Remote Nurse |
|---|---|---|
| Credentials | Healthcare-related certifications, e.g., medical assistant, paramedic | Registered Nurse (RN) license, nursing certifications |
| Work Environment | Healthcare facilities, hospitals, clinics, or remote health services | Hospitals, clinics, telehealth platforms, or remote patient care |
| Employer & Industry | Healthcare providers, hospitals, telehealth companies | Hospitals, clinics, telehealth services, healthcare organizations |
| Work Schedule | Rotational shifts, including nights and weekends | Shift-based, often including nights, weekends, and on-call hours |
Remote Rota refers to a scheduling system for healthcare staff working in shifts, often in hospitals or clinics, while Remote Nurse specifically involves nursing professionals providing patient care remotely. Both roles require healthcare credentials and involve shift work, but their work environments and responsibilities differ.
